Output 4f525b7c348afecff61cd09404dc43004d0656c829884076ff6d75aa637e9e73:3

value
17420000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b9e0986768146b7ee1b5484492d0a153c704aca9 OP_EQUAL
address
3JdqzBwBkCnhXnaEFk37aBZ6ya4rxBAZMk
transaction
4f525b7c348afecff61cd09404dc43004d0656c829884076ff6d75aa637e9e73
confirmations
302719
spent
true